In this section, we focus on the application of weighted graphs and how to minimize the distance, time or cost of our graph based on those weights. Dijkstra's algorithm will be our guide in determining the paths of least weight. It is important to note that this does NOT provide us with a minimum spanning tree (MST), but simply the cheapest path from one vertex to EACH other vertex in our graph.
